American Legion
Post 283 Pickerington
In early 1981, nearly 30 veterans of the Pickerington area met in the Pickerington High School to form an American Legion Post (it has been reported that an American Legion Post had previously existed in Pickerington in 1919 though this post’s name and number is unknown). A decision was made by the membership to honor the memory of Pickerington High School's only casualty of the VietNam War. The David Johnston Memorial Post, stands as a lasting tribute to Corporal David Johnston, MIKE Company/3rd Battalion/5th Regiment/1st Marine Division who was killed in action during OPERATION TAYLOR COMMON, 3 March 1969 in Quang Nam Province, South Viet Nam.
